Page 12: ...4 bit and above 5 USING THE HEADSET POWER BUTTON Power on or off the headset by holdingthe Power button until the status indicator is on and holding the Power button again to turn off Two distinct tones will help notifyyou that the headset is powered on or off ...

Page 13: ...status While in use you ll hear a tone when the headset needs to be recharged duringsuch time the indicator will continue showingthe batterylevel until you charge the headset HYPERSENSE BUTTON With Razer HyperSense enabled your headset will produce vibrations that flowin the direction of different sounds with varyingintensities makingyou hyper aware in your game Simplypress the Single press Play p...

Page 14: ...cycle through its settings Razer HyperSense also works on 3 5 mm analog connection when the headset is on Distinct tones however are only available on wireless By default this feature is enabled and set to Medium intensity VOLUME CONTROL WHEEL Rotate the volume control wheel to increase or decrease the volume Intensity Vibration Low Short Medium High Disable Long Decrease volume Increase volume ...

Page 22: ...udio received to avoid sudden and unpleasant increase in volume from effects such as shoutingor explosions Voice Clarity Enhances the qualityofincoming voice conversations byfilteringthe sound to improveits clarityand volume Audio Equalizer Select any of the available equalizer presets created for the best audio experience designed for balance gaming immersion movie viewing or enjoyingyour favorit...

Page 23: ...audio Microphone Control the mic volume and amount of mic input for a clearer mic audio Mic Volume Adjust the microphone input or mute the mic Voice Gate Control the amount ofmic input so that it cuts out background noises and isolates your voice Any sound that registers belowthe threshold will be muted ...

Page 24: ...cy Ambient Noise Reduction Decreases environmentalnoise Mic Equalizer Select any of the available micequalizer presets which best fits your mic needs Manuallyadjusting any equalizer preset will automaticallyset it as a Custom preset Mic Monitoring Sidetone Enable this settingto monitor the microphone s raw audio input through the headset with an additional option to increase or decrease the audio ...
